logo

Output 893c89993ab70502131cf37050633dc92612b426e9553635b101a430856cb748:0

value
12937731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7efadf6950fd32060fb9808ced54fe5e214633d1 OP_EQUAL
address
3DGRbexQtVvY2SsXH8cXWQ7XCVzemnUfAB
transaction
893c89993ab70502131cf37050633dc92612b426e9553635b101a430856cb748